On June 2nd, in Hanoi, Politburo Member, National Assembly Chairman Tran Thanh Man chaired a working session with National Assembly leaders on the implementation of tasks for May and key tasks for June 2026.
Concluding the meeting, National Assembly Chairman Tran Thanh Man stated clearly that the double-digit growth target is a political order, a people's expectation.
In that context, legislative work must have a strong change, shifting from the mindset of "manage to where regulate to there" to the mindset of creating development, controlling risks and promoting innovation.
Agencies proactively coordinate in appraising draft laws, resolutions, and ordinances submitted to the 2nd Session; prepare for the thematic session on law-making if practical requirements require.
Request to accelerate the progress of the general review of the system of legal normative documents, report on progress periodically every 2 weeks, promptly detect and propose handling of overlapping, contradictory, and no longer appropriate regulations.
At the same time, prepare carefully for the 3rd session of the National Assembly Standing Committee, in which pay attention to contents on finance, budget, and resolutions on the People's Court system.
The National Assembly Chairwoman said that supervision must be more substantive, more effective and pursue the implementation results to the end, ensuring that all supervision recommendations and voter recommendations are considered and resolved promptly.
It is necessary to urgently prepare a Plan and thematic supervision outline on the implementation of policies and laws in the management and use of working headquarters after arranging the organizational structure and administrative units.
Carefully prepare the National Assembly's Forum on supervision activities for the 2nd time in 2026; develop a Project to organize a National Conference on people's aspirations and supervision.
Completing the Resolution guiding the implementation of the Law on Supervisory Activities of the National Assembly and People's Councils in coordinating supervision of the implementation of international treaties and agreements.

Promote digital transformation, science and technology and the application of artificial intelligence. Digital transformation must create substantive changes in the working methods of the National Assembly.
All processes must be gradually operated on a digital platform; all policies must be supported by reliable, timely and accurate data. AI must become an effective support tool in the entire legislative, supervisory, and decision-making process of the country's important issues.
Assessing that the workload from now until the end of the year is still very large and the requirements are increasingly high, the National Assembly Chairwoman stated clearly, "the most important thing at this time is to turn determination into action, turn programs into results, turn assigned tasks into specific products, measurable and bring real value to people, businesses and national development".
National Assembly Chairman Tran Thanh Man said "what is clear should be done immediately; what is still stuck should be reported immediately; what is slow must state the causes and responsibilities. Do not allow the situation of circular documents, formal coordination, and many opinions requested but no plan was finalized".
The National Assembly Chairman requested that all tasks must have output products. Not evaluating by the number of meetings, but evaluating by the quality of documents, quality of advice, quality of appraisal, quality of supervision and actual effectiveness.
Maintain strict discipline and order, ensure progress but not sacrifice quality. Fast but must be sure; drastic but must be in accordance with the law; innovate but must have a basis...
